Tom Hardy shoots a fight scene in latest Venom set photos and videos

December 17, 2017 by Gary Collinson

As filming on Venom continues in Atlanta, some new set photos and video have arrived online from the Sony-produced Spider-Man spinoff which see Tom Hardy’s Eddie Brock in a fight scene with Scott Haze (Only the Brave), who is playing an as-yet-unrevealed villain. Check them out here…

As yet, we have no idea which character Haze is portraying, although we do know that the movie is taking inspiration from the Lethal Protector story arc (along with Planet of the Symbiotes), which sees Venom battling five new offspring of the symbiote, so it is entirely possible that he’s playing one of those characters.

Directed by Ruben Fleischer (Zombieland), Venom is set for release on October 5th 2018 and features a cast that includes Tom Hardy, Riz Ahmed, Michelle Williams, Woody Harrelson, Jenny Slate, Reid Scott and Scott Haze.
